The Kindle reader could also be categorised as a multi-tasking device. After all, in addition to it’s main role as an e-book reader, it can be used as a web browser. When it comes to surfing the net, the Kindle is admittedly a little limited – mainly as a result of its display, which is monochrome and has a relatively slow refresh rate – which makes it unsuitable for video playback.
However, it is exactly the Kindle’s e-ink technology display which makes it so much better to read books on that either a computer screen or an iPod. The fact that the e-ink display is not back-lit means that it produces much less eye strain than a back-lit LCD monitor.
Another benefit of e-ink technology displays is the fact that they only draw power when the screen is being refreshed. This means that e-book readers can go for long spells on a single battery charge. It’s the ideal scenario for a portable battery operated device. Typically, e-book readers can last for several thousand “page turns” between charges. For the average reader, that will equate to anything between four and six weeks of use.
So, somewhat ironically, the very thing that makes e-book readers ideal for reading books on – the e-ink technology display – currently puts a slight limitation on their performance in other areas – such as video display and surfing the internet. In all probability, color e-ink displays with faster refresh rates will be available in future and devices, such as the Kindle, will become better suited for use in different areas.
In the meantime, based upon the fact that e-book readers are very much the hot gadget of the moment, it does look as if there is still a place for devices which do one job only. Just so long as, like the Amazon Kindle, they do that one job very well.
